Maggie Tran currently teaches Advanced Placement US History, US History, and World History Honors courses at McLean High School in McLean, Virginia. She earned her BS in History with an emphasis on European History and Secondary Education from Appalachian State University and a Masters of Education from the University of Virginia.
She was a member of the History Department at West Springfield High School in Virginia that won the 2005 American Historical Association’s Beveridge Family Teaching Award, and in 2010 she was named West Springfield High’s Teacher of the Year. She has served as a Master Teacher for American Council of History Education, National Council for History Education, and Teaching American History teacher programs in eight states. From 1998 until 2006 she served as a Faculty Consultant for the Advanced Placement US History Exam. She has presented on team teaching strategies for the Vietnam War at national meetings of the National Council for the Social Studies.
